Subject: Can inet_create return -EPROTONOSUPPORT
Date: Fri, 29 Nov 2002 11:04:41 -0500 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<BA0CFA49.4345%dufresne@mediafusion.com> (raw)
Hi,
In inet_create, after the lookup for the requested type/protocol pair,
there's a test to see if protocol == 0. Why? Because when protocol == 0,
answer == NULL.
Correct me if I'm wrong, please. ;-)
